An in-depth conversation with historian and lawyer Yasser Latif Hamdani on Muhammad Ali Jinnah, Pakistan’s founding ideology, and the making of a nation. We explore the debates around secularism, Islam, and Jinnah’s vision, tracing how Pakistan’s identity evolved. 00:00 - Jinnah’s & His Life; Partition History; Special Focus on Jinnah as a Lawyer & Legislator

16:00 – The Failed Dialogue: When Two Gujaratis Couldn’t See Eye to Eye

21:20 – Gandhi Hurt Jinnah's Ego? Did Gandhi and Jinnah Ever Forgive Each Other?

25:40 – Why Was Jinnah Against the Khilafat Movement?

41:00 – Jinnah Between Two Worlds: Bridging the Muslim League and Congress

51:45 – Celebrations on the End of Congress: Why Did Congress Fail

58:30 – Elected by Majority of India: Jinnah’s Unlikely National Mandate

1:01:30 – Pakistan Movement? Why Jinnah Allied with the British

1:10:20 – Faith and State: Did Jinnah Want a Theological Pakistan?

1:24:50 – Jinnah and Today: What Would He Think of TLP and Its Ban?
